A beautiful robust specimen of the classic Pyrites from the famous Huanzala Mine in Peru. This piece is loaded with highly lustrous (splendent), sharp, very well-formed, striated, metallic golden colored pyritohedral crystals measuring up to 3.1 cm, sitting on massive Pyrite matrix. The piece is in good shape overall, though some small nicks / roughness can be seen here and there. The brightness of the luster is difficult to convey through even the accompanying video for this listing, so I will say that the piece looks very good in person, and probably better than the video would suggest.
